McLaren's rise: Lando Norris praises Andrea Stella for transformative impact

Andrea Stella

In a season of highs and lows, McLaren's resurgence in Formula 1 under the guidance of team principal Andrea Stella has left an indelible mark on the paddock.

The journey from a challenging start to finishing fourth in the Constructors' Championship has not gone unnoticed by the team's star driver, Lando Norris.

Stella, who assumed the role of Team Principal at the beginning of the season, inherited a team grappling with performance issues with the MCL60 car. However, as the season unfolded, McLaren's form underwent a dramatic turnaround, culminating in nine podium finishes and a commendable fourth-place finish in the Constructors' Championship.

Norris, in recognizing the collective effort of the McLaren team, reserved special praise for Stella, emphasizing the pivotal role he played in orchestrating the team's success. The British driver acknowledged Stella's impact, likening him to the director of a production, steering the ensemble towards excellence.

"I did an interview the other day, and I just said a big thanks to him," Norris shared with the media. "Andrea is just the director of it all. He's the producer of the set, and everyone else is the cast. But you need everyone to work together very well, and that's what they're doing."

Norris emphasized that Stella's influence extended beyond his role as Team Principal, crediting him for his continued involvement in the day-to-day racing and qualifying activities. The Briton expressed his satisfaction with Stella's leadership, stating, "I couldn't ask for a better team principal. So a big thanks to him."

As the curtain falls on the 2023 F1 season and teams and drivers enjoy a well-deserved break, the focus now shifts to the anticipation of the upcoming 2024 season. Official F1 pre-season testing is set to kick off at the Bahrain International Circuit in Sakhir from February 23-25, offering teams an early glimpse into the potential dynamics of the new season.
